If you don't see these files, search on all your MAC for the location of these files, they should be installed elsewhere and you need to move the plugin files and folder at the good place ! Please see the following screenshot (for mac, the extension of files is different). Inside that folder the BM plugin files are composed of 2 files and 1 folder. Let's see how to do this.Īfter installing the BRAW plugin in you MAC, you should have the plugin files in your Adobe Mediacore folder, which is generally located in : /Library/Application Support/Adobe/Common/Plug-ins/7.0/MediaCore ![]() ![]() ![]() Check your MediaCore folder, and move things into the right folder if they're not. Sometimes on installation the files are not put in the correct folders. Are you using the Blackmagic BRAW plugin ?
